  • No, on their extra easy plan you have free foods (eg eggs, lean meat, potatoes, wholemeal rice and apsta, quark, baked beans in saunce) that you can eat unlimited and then 1 healthy dairy choice ( eg 28g cheese) per day and 1 healthy b choice (eg 2 weetabix) per day plus 15 syns (eg a milky way has 6 syns). there is a list of healthy a and b choices and all foods are given a syn value unless they are free.

    im getting married at the beginning of december, i joined slimming world in March and so far ive lost 3 stone 2 1/2 pounds following the extra easy plan, ive gone from a large 16 (probably 18) to a small 14 and im nearly in a 12 so im really pleased. ive got less than a stone to go to reach target but im not fussed if i dont do it before the wedding. ive got enough pressure at the minute trying to organise everything without analysing every pound. ive had slip ups on the way but as long as its coming i dont care how slow it is.

    I think the trick is to find out what works for you, i love slimming world but one of my friends just cant get on with it so everybodys different.
